Norman Walsh PicNorman Walsh is an XML Standards Architect at Sun Microsystems, Inc. and an active participant in a number of standards efforts worldwide.

Mr Walsh is an elected member of the Technical Architecture Group at the W3C where he is also chair of the XML Processing Model Working Group, co-chair of the XML Core Working Group, and an active member of the XSL Working Group. At OASIS, he is chair of the DocBook Technical Committee and a member of several other technical committees. He is one of the specification leads for the Java API for XML Processing (JAXP) in the Java community Process.

With more than a decade of industry experience, Mr. Walsh is well known for his work on DocBook, on open source projects, and for the numerous works he has published. He is the principle author of DocBook: The Definitive Guide. Before joining Sun, he developed XML and SGML publishing systems for Arbortext, Inc., and O'Reilly and Associates.
